COMMERCE BUSINESS DAILY ISSUE OF JANUARY 15,1999 PSA#2263

Defense Information Systems Agency, DITCO-NCR, 701 South Court House Road, Arlington, VA 22204-2199

D -- EMPLOYEE BENEFITS WEB SITE SOL DCA100-99-Q-4005 DUE 012099 POC Chrissie Fields, Contract Specialist (703)607-6911 or Randy Grey, Contracting Officer (703)607-6905 This modification is being done to provide information to answer vendor technical and functional questions related to the Employee Benefits Web Site. TECHNICAL QUESTIONS: -- The Web site will be hosted on an existing DISA server within the DISA domain. The actual Web server software is WebSite Pro ver 2.0 from O'Reilly software. The server operates in a Windows NT4.0 environment. The hardware will be provided by DISA. -- There are currently firewalls in place. The required protocol filtering will be arranged by D1 Automation and the DISC design branch at DISA. -- DISA's guidance on the development of its web pages are located at http://www.disa.mil/handbook/toc.html -- Database server software, configuration, and installation will be provided by the vendor. Since DISA has other Oracle based applications, that database engine is required. -- The current HR system for DISA is the DOD wide system Defense Civilian Personnel Data System (DCPDS). The payroll system is Defense Civilian Payroll System (DCPS). Both systems are managed by DOD central design activities. -- Data import from the HR and Pay systems of record (DCPDS and DCPS) will be in delimited text format. (electronic copy) -- Future use of this system as an input source to the HR and Pay systems will necessitate tracking/auditing of changes made through the developed system. -- DOD PKI security measures and tools will be used for this system. -- Access to the system will be through the DISA Network Operations Center (NOC) which is a 24 X 7 operation. -- At present, the compatibility browsers at the IE3.0 is firm. The Agency has upgraded to Netscape Communicator 4.05. -- All reference to links for purposes of the initial implementation are related to hyper link to other Web pages and not to any data source. FUNCTIONAL QUESTIONS: -It is necessary to support the FERS Transfer requirement even though open season for employees transferring from CSRS to FERS ended December 31, 1998. -We require a retirement calculator that can handle 100% of possible permutations including calculations based on breaks in service, military service, repayment of withdrawal funds, etc. -6500 employees included in the web site files -500 concurrent users -Information pertaining to employee benefits to be accessed by employees is defined in the Requirements Section 1.1.1.-1.9.4. -The system is not expected to let the user see how his/her profile has changed -- no historical data saved -Later if the system becomes an input source to the various feed systems, allowing the user to update preferences, the system will need to track which changes were made through it -No photos of employees or graphics production will be used OTHER INFORMATION -Proposals will be evaluated on "Best Value" -An Independent Government Cost Estimate will not be provided to vendors -For the submission format see FAR 52-212-1 -This will be a basic award with four option years Posted 01/13/99 (W-SN287623).
